Haas F1 Team Friday Practice at Sochi recap

Haas F1 Team ran a total of 88 laps split equally among its two pilots. Preparations for Sunday’s Russian Grand Prix began under a partly sunny sky, with the opening practice session at Sochi Autodrom affording Haas F1 Team valuable mileage. The 90-minute session Friday morning at the 5.848-kilometer (3.634-mile), 18-turn track highlighted the circuit’s lack of grip, with a multitude of cars experiencing brief, off-track excursions at the beginning of the session. The early pace was set by Mercedes, with championship point-leader Nico Rosberg setting the fastest lap (1:38.127) after a mid-session switch to the Pirelli P Zero Red supersoft tire.
